Edmund Turner, Anderson County, Texas, 1867
Edmund Turner registered to vote in Anderson County on August 29, 1867. He reported Virginia as his birthplace and 8 years in Texas, 8 of them in Anderson County. The registrar wrote "Colored" beside his name. Anderson County registered 976 freedmen in 1867, 47% of its voters.

This entry comes from the 1867 to 1870 Texas voter registration, the Texas Secretary of State registration lists held by the Texas State Library and Archives Commission. It sits on page 33 of the Anderson County volume, written out by hand. About Enslaved Texas.
